Marma points are ‘the various points on the body where the subtle life energy becomes matter, where thoughts transfer into the physical’. Marma points link to the subtle channels called nadis. Gentle pressure on the marma points release blocks and allows prana (life energy) to flow to the connecting organ or tissue.
It is potentially the most restorative of the ayurvedic treatments.

Marma Chikitsa is a widely popular technique.
It is simple and effective, with minimum equipment, it can be practiced anywhere.
